Our new Gen2 lever design is stronger and lighter, and adds a little style to the lever body. The revised webbed pockets in the lever body remove more material while increasing the strength. A divit cut in the lever body causes only the end of the lever to break off in the event of a severe crash, leaving some functionality so that the bike can be moved or perhaps ridden away.
